Match Preview:

Manchester United will be looking to get back to winning ways after losing back to back games against Fulham and Manchester City which has stalled the club in 6th place. West Ham are only two points behind and Newcastle are lurking in the shadows too and it seems that United’s best possible finish this season will be sixth. Last weekend the club were involved in the Manchester derby and had taken a 1-0 lead into half time but as the game wore on City’s relentless attacking and class told in the end and United lost 3-1. 

Erik ten Hag’s side are six points adrift of fifth placed Tottenham and the club has just the 10th best home record in the league with 22 points won from 39. While there have been 7 wins at home there should be caution with 5 defeats added, Bournemouth have lost the same amount of games at home and there remains problems at the club that is for sure. 

Everton still has no wins in 2024 and that is a major concern for a club who still face an FFP charge soon. Everton are 5 points clear of the bottom three having gotten back four of their points from the first charge. Last weekend was interesting for Everton because despite yet another defeat which came at home at the hands of West Ham in a game that finished 3-1 all remained the same for the Toffees. Nottingham Forest and Luton the two clubs just below them both lost, but Everton are not always going to get away with it. On the road Everton have lost 5 but won 5 and their last match on the road finished in a 1-1 draw with Brighton, the club would rank in 9th place based on away form alone.

 

Team News:

Manchester United: Rasmus Hojlund is out for at least three weeks with a muscle injury, Harry Maguire could be assessed to return from a knock. Lisandro Martinez will not return until the end of the month from a knee injury. Aaron Wan Bissaka, Luke Shaw, Tyrell Malacia, Anthony Martial and Mason Mount are all out long term with no fixed return dates.

Everton: Idrissa Gueye is nearing a return from a groin injury but is only 50/50 to make this game and looks a doubt. Arnaut Danjuma and Dele Alli are both out long term with respective ankle and groin injuries.

 

Man Utd vs Everton Head to Head: 

Last season Manchester United won this fixture 2-0.

Manchester United have won the last four meetings in a row.

Everton have won just once from the past 11 meetings at that was a home game.
